New York (CNN Business) Town Sports International, the owner of hundreds of gyms mostly on the US east coast, has filed for bankruptcy. The 47-year-old company owns several gym chains, including New York Sports Club, Boston Sports Club and Lucille Roberts. Town Sports CLUB listed liabilities of $500 million to $1 billion in its filing. The company warned in June about a potential bankruptcy because the "scope and duration of the interruption to our operations has substantially reduced our cash flow." "We anticipate that the Covid-19 pandemic will continue to negatively impact our operating results in future periods," Town Sports said.
